About Me

Jackie is a seasoned mindfulness practitioner who regularly attends silent retreats. She skillfully guides clients in cultivating self-awareness and accessing their inner strengths. She has a profound interest in trauma treatment, a trauma-informed therapist who incorporates approaches such as EMDR, mindfulness-based interventions, somatic psychology, polyvagal theory, neurobiology, attachment theory, and Internal Family Systems (IFS). Grounded in mindfulness, she helps clients navigate their window of tolerance with skill and confidence.

Education & Experience

Jackie has a Master Degree in Guidance and Counselling, is a Certified Clinical Trauma Professional Level 2 (CCTP-II), a Full Member of EMDR Singapore, and is trained to work with dissociative conditions, including DID (Dissociative Identity Disorder). Jackie is also a National Career Development Association (NCDA) certified career counselor (CCC). Jackie’s diverse career journey—from multinational corporations to the helping and education industry—has equipped her with a unique blend of global business experience and deep expertise in career coaching and counseling.

Professional & Volunteer Affiliations

Since 2013, Jackie has volunteered with the Singapore Prison Service, providing group counseling and psychoeducation on topics including substance addiction, social reintegration, anger management, informed decision-making, and mindfulness. In recognition of her dedication, she received the Singapore Prison Service 10-Year Long Service Award in 2023.
